site stats

Mysql case when syntax

WebThe MySQL case statements are the expressions used for flow control; they help with conditional operations like adding if-else logic. MySQL case statement works similarly to that in other programming languages. There are one or more than one conditions that the MySQL case statement has to go through. The MySQL case statement returns the value ... WebJul 27, 2024 · In MySQL, the CASE statement has the same functionality as the IF-THEN-ELSE statement and has two syntaxes. Syntax 1: In this syntax, CASE matches the value with the values “value1”, “value2”, etc., and returns the corresponding statement. If the value is not equal to any values, CASE returns the statement in the ELSE clause if it is ...

How to use Mysql SELECT CASE WHEN expression

WebUsing: MySQL Server5.5.13, Hibernate 4.1.1, JDK 1.6 . 我按照以上的思路,改造了我的show属性,可是还是不成功,由此可见,我的问题只是与上面这个问题相似,但不是由以上原因引起的。还有一些人建议should not use BIT columns in MySQL,建议使用tinyint,但也不是问题的主要原因。 WebApr 9, 2024 · I have run the query through several syntax checkers and it checks out. Here is the query - Note that I have removed many cases, but it seems it has to do with the JSON_VALUE function, so reducing the query to just this case fails as well. st peter\u0027s moustache https://lgfcomunication.com

What should I learn first SQL or MySQL? - Quora

WebSep 5, 2024 · Here is the complete CASE statement and query for MySQL: Syntax 2. The 2nd CASE syntax is ideal for testing discrete values against two or more conditions. For example, we could use it to add a target audience column based on the film rating: Conclusion. In today's blog we learned how the SQL CASE Statement can be employed to … WebThe syntax of the CASE operator described here differs slightly from that of the SQL CASE statement described in Section 13.6.5.1, “CASE Statement”, for use inside stored … WebMay 14, 2013 · In your case, it should be the first syntax, because you are not comparing to specific values but to a range. Instead, your query is actually using the second syntax. The count(*)<=0 expression is evaluated to a boolean which is then implicitly converted to an integer, the type implied by the DATEDIFF result. rothesay post building

MySQL :: MySQL 5.7 Reference Manual :: 12.5 Flow …

Category:MySQL :: MySQL 5.7 Reference Manual :: 12.5 Flow Control …

Tags:Mysql case when syntax

Mysql case when syntax

How to use Mysql SELECT CASE WHEN expression

WebAug 1, 2024 · Syntax 1: CASE WHEN in MySQL with Multiple Conditions. …. In this syntax, CASE matches ‘value’ with “value1”, “value2”, etc., and returns the corresponding statement. If ‘value’ is not equal to any values CASE returns the statement in ELSE clause if ELSE clause is specified. ELSE 'Level doesn`t exist!'. WebMar 7, 2013 · 4. This should work: select id ,action_heading ,case when action_type='Income' then action_amount else 0 end ,case when action_type='Expense' then expense_amount else 0 end from tbl_transaction. Share. Improve this answer. Follow. answered Mar 7, 2013 at 7:57. Dumitrescu Bogdan. 7,097 2 23 31.

Mysql case when syntax

Did you know?

WebFeb 8, 2024 · CASE () Function in MySQL. CASE () function in MySQL is used to find a value by passing over conditions whenever any condition satisfies the given statement otherwise it returns the statement in an else part. However, when a condition is satisfied it stops reading further and returns the output. WebMySQL CASE Statement с несколькими столбцами в statement list У меня есть вот такой запрос, который я знаю не работает, но я его оставил как есть псевдокод, чтобы помочь объяснить, что я делаю.

WebThe CASE statement cannot have an ELSE NULL clause, and it is terminated with END CASE instead of END . For the first syntax, case_value is an expression. This value is compared …

WebTable 12.13 String Comparison Functions and Operators. If a string function is given a binary string as an argument, the resulting string is also a binary string. A number converted to a string is treated as a binary string. This affects only comparisons. Normally, if any expression in a string comparison is case-sensitive, the comparison is ... Web13.1 Data Definition Statements. 13.2 Data Manipulation Statements. 13.3 Transactional and Locking Statements. 13.4 Replication Statements. 13.5 Prepared Statements. 13.6 Compound Statement Syntax. 13.7 Database Administration Statements. 13.8 Utility Statements. This chapter describes the syntax for the SQL statements supported by …

WebThe CASE statement goes through conditions and return a value when the first condition is met (like an IF-THEN-ELSE statement). So, once a condition is true, it will stop reading and return the result. If no conditions are true, it will return the value in the ELSE clause. If … Value Description; DATE: Converts value to DATE. Format: "YYYY-MM-DD" … Coalesce - MySQL CASE Function - W3School The Try-MySQL Editor at w3schools.com MySQL Database: Restore Database. Get …

WebJan 25, 2024 · How to Write Case Statement in MySQL. Here is the syntax for MySQL Case statement. select case when condition1 then value1 when condition2 then value2 ... end, … rothesay policyWebMySQL CASE is a MySQL Statement query keyword that defines the way to handle the loop concepts to execute the set of conditions and return the match case using IF ELSE. CASE … rothesay post office opening hoursWebMay 6, 2024 · MYSQL Case When Statement. MySQL CASE WHEN statement is used to control situations where a value can take different values. It is also similar to the MySQL … rothesay powersports saint johnWebHow it works. First, the CASE statement returns 1 if the status equals the corresponding status such as Shipped, on hold, in Process, Cancelled, Disputed and zero otherwise.; … st peter\u0027s neurology latham nyWebThe syntax of the CASE operator described here differs slightly from that of the SQL CASE statement described in Section 13.6.5.1, “CASE Statement”, for use inside stored programs.The CASE statement cannot have an ELSE NULL clause, and it is terminated with END CASE instead of END. rothesay postcodeWebHere, the SQL command checks each row with the given case. If age is greater than or equal to 18, the result set contains. columns with customer_id and first_name with their values; Allowed is returned as a can_vote column. Example: CASE in SQL. Note: The syntax of CASE always starts with the CASE keyword and ends with the END keyword followed ... st peter\u0027s ncaa tournament historyWebJul 31, 2016 · SELECT t.name, t.colour, CASE WHEN (t.Amount < 0) THEN t.Amount END AS small, CASE WHEN (t.Amount > 0) THEN t.Amount END AS large FROM t Understanding … rothesay post office opening times